Position Summary

This role reports to the Contracts Executive and provides the primary administrative support for the contracting process for the BLA group throughout EMEA and Latin America, including EDOCS filing, updating of relevant data bases including Hive, other internal project tracking mechanisms, the approval of music cue sheets and other administrative tasks. 

Other responsibilities include: support for the BLA team undertaking simple drafting and negotiation of music licences, acquisition amendments and renewals and similar; research to support market and business intelligence projects; preparation, analysis and presentation of data to support those projects; preparation and collation in support of the Contracts Executive of the monthly content activity reports required for the Content Committee.

Responsibilities

Administrative

 

  • track all acquisitions commissions, co-productions, talent and other agreements negotiated by the BLA team, generate Business Intelligence reports when requested;
  • scan and file all agreements concluded by the team and manage the signature process directly through to full execution;
  • liaise as necessary internally to co-ordinate the signature of contracts;
  • timely update internal systems with the status of agreements and other contractual details;
  • liaise where requested on ascertaining rights availability including researching queries in general;
  • act as a point of contact for suppliers and internal clients about late payments, and other administrative enquiries;
  • provide administrative support to the BLA Team in the absence of the departmental PA;
  • where requested, track down relevant agreements to assist the executives in their negotiation activities;
  • support the collation, preparation and submission of the monthly content reports generated for the Content Committee;
  • approve music cue sheets using the Soundmouse system and query any discrepancies.  Ensure any such queries are resolved in a timely manner.
  • undertake simple drafting and negotiation of music clearance licences with record companies and publishers;
  • working with the BLA executives, draft and prepare simple amendment letters, renewal agreements;
  • support business and market intelligence projects with research, analysis and presentation of data;
  • review agreements where requested to provide a simple outline of their content.
  • support the BLA Team in the absence of the Contracts Executive
